Berkshire Hathaway Inc. will swap about $1.4 billion in shares of Phillips 66 for full ownership of the energy firm’s pipeline-services business as billionaire Warren Buffett expands his bet on oil transportation.

Berkshire will exchange about 19 million shares, Phillips 66 said in a regulatory filing yesterday, when the energy company closed at $74.72 in New York. The exact number of shares Berkshire will pay for Phillips Specialty Products Inc. will be determined when the deal is completed, Phillips 66 said.
